Aggregate Industries Inc
Aggregate Industries operates seven regional
construction materials businesses in the United States. These
regional businesses participate in all sectors of the construction
industry, supplying aggregates-based materials and contracting
services to a wide range of projects including large, publicly
financed infrastructure projects, commercial, and residential
developments.
The core business of producing crushed stone and sand and gravel is
enhanced by added value operations that produce ready-mixed
concrete, asphalt, and concrete products. In addition, recycling,
liquid asphalt, soil remediation and retailing businesses are also
undertaken, creating true, vertically integrated businesses.
Total turnover for Aggregate Industries Inc. in 2006 was $1,704m
and its sales volumes were:
Aggregates 49.9m tons
Asphalt 9.2m tons
Ready-mixed concrete 6.2m cu yds
Pre-cast concrete 6.9m sq ft
Concrete Blocks 11.4m EIE's
(EIE = Eight Inch Equivalents)
Our US regions are:
The
Northeast Region serving markets in eastern Massachusetts
including the Boston metropolitan area and Worcester, Massachusetts
and in southern New Hampshire, including the Manchester and Nashua
markets. Aggregate Industries supports this market with its
requirements for aggregates, asphalt, and ready-mixed concrete.
The region also operates liquid asphalt (bitumen) terminals,
soil remediation facilities and environmentally responsible asphalt
and concrete recycling centers;
The
Mid Atlantic Region which supplies aggregates, asphalt
and ready-mixed concrete to markets in Washington DC, Maryland,
northern Virginia, and West Virginia. This region also operates
recycling facilities and an architectural stone product outlet
known as Stone Garden Hardscapes;
The
Central Region which supplies aggregates, asphalt and
contracting services, ready-mixed concrete, concrete products and
construction supplies to customers in its’ markets in southwest
Michigan and northern Indiana. This includes markets surrounding
Grand Rapids, Kalamazoo, Lansing and Jackson, Michigan and South
Bend and Elkhart in Indiana;
The Meyer Material Company
acquired in July 2006 and supplies aggregates,
ready-mixed concrete and concrete paving to customers in and around
the Northwestern part of metropolitan Chicago and southeastern
Wisconsin. Business brands include Paveloc, which specialises in
the supply of premium paving products.
The
North Central Region suppling aggregates, asphalt,
ready-mixed concrete, recycling services, contracting services and
pre cast concrete products through the Masterblock brand to central
Minnesota, especially the twin cities of Minneapolis-St. Paul, as
well as eastern North Dakota and small parts of western
Wisconsin.;
The
West Central Region
serving the metropolitan Denver and northern Front Range markets
in Colorado. We are the largest ready-mixed concrete producer in
Colorado and a leading producer of aggregates and asphalt in the
greater Denver metropolitan market.
The
Southwest Region which encompasses our businesses in the
southwest serving the Las Vegas valley including Nevada, Utah and
Denver and the metropolitan market in Colorado. In Nevada we
produce aggregates, asphalt and ready-mixed concrete and have
significant construction and surfacing businesses.
